UVA offers several different parking options, each with its own set of rules, restrictions, and advantages. Here’s a breakdown of the main types:

Permit Parking at UVA

Permit parking is typically reserved for season ticket holders, donors, and other individuals affiliated with the University. Access to these lots requires a valid parking permit, which is usually distributed in advance of the season. These lots often provide the closest proximity to the stadium. Some popular permit parking locations include the John Paul Jones Arena lots and other designated areas surrounding the stadium complex.

The cost of a parking permit varies depending on factors such as donation level, seating location, and membership status. Permit holders may also face specific restrictions, such as designated arrival times and regulations regarding tailgating activities. Always double-check the details outlined on your permit to ensure compliance and avoid any potential issues.

Cash Parking Near the Stadium

For those without a parking permit, cash parking offers a convenient alternative, although it often requires a bit more walking. Cash parking lots are typically located further away from Scott Stadium than permit parking areas. These lots operate on a first-come, first-served basis, so arriving early is essential to secure a spot.

The cost of cash parking varies depending on the event and the location of the lot, but you can generally expect a set fee. While cash parking might require a longer walk, it offers the flexibility of paying upon arrival and avoiding the commitment of a season-long permit. However, keep in mind that availability is not guaranteed, especially for high-demand games.

Accessible Parking Options

The University of Virginia is committed to providing accessible parking options for individuals with disabilities. Designated accessible parking spaces are available in various lots surrounding Scott Stadium. To access these spaces, a valid disability placard or license plate is required.

Shuttle services may be provided from accessible parking areas to the stadium entrance, ensuring a convenient and comfortable experience for all attendees. Contact the UVA Athletics Department or parking services for specific details about accessible parking locations, shuttle schedules, and any necessary accommodations.

Exploring Alternative Transportation Options

If driving seems too daunting, consider alternative transportation methods to reach Scott Stadium.

Ride-Sharing Services

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ft offer a convenient way to get to and from the stadium. Designated drop-off and pick-up locations are typically established near Scott Stadium, allowing you to avoid the hassle of parking altogether. Be mindful of potential surge pricing during peak hours and factor that into your budget.

Public Transportation

The Charlottesville Area Transit (CAT) system provides public transportation throughout the city, including routes that service the Scott Stadium area. Check the CAT website for route maps, schedules, and fare information.

The Joys of Walking and Biking

If you live within a reasonable distance of Scott Stadium, consider walking or biking to the game. This is a healthy and environmentally friendly way to avoid parking altogether. Bike racks are typically available near the stadium for secure storage.
